We spent several summers in Handersonville, NC ,it is one of our favorite spots away from FL . I always enjoy hiking at Dupont State Forest to several waterfalls ( High falls , triple falls,etc.) . You can stop by at visitor's office and get a free trail-detailed map of the Dupont Forest . This area offers vast amount of trail network to satisfy the novice and the hard-core backpacker and anything in between . My second favorite hiking place in Hendersonville is Karl Sandburg's estate (spelling ?) . This estate is currently a state park and open to public for hiking (free ) . From here you can take shorter hikes or longer hikes to Glass Mtn. Good luck and have a safe trip.
